Let's look at who beat us.
The "worst" team to beat us was Michigan State.
They beat us 40-31 - with Penix playing the whole game.
They were 3-1 and ranked No. 25.
They had just beaten NW 31-10.
We would eventually beat NW 34-3 with Ramsey.
They lost at Ohio State 34-10
We lost to Ohio State 51-10 with Ramsey getting his first replacement start.
They lost to Penn State at home 28-7.
We lost to Penn State at Penn State 34-27.
They lost to Michigan at Michigan 44-10.
We lost to Michigan 39-14.
They beat Rutgers 27-0.
We beat Rutgers 35-0.
They beat Maryland 19-16.
We beat Maryland 34-28.
Yeah - they beat us, but I'd say its fair to say we were competitive and comparable to MSU.
The next best team to beat us - Michigan.
They beat us 39-14.
They beat Rutgers 52-0, Maryland 38-7, MSU 44-10.
We beat Rutgers 35-0, Maryland 34-28, and lost to MSU 40-31.
We gave Penn State as good a game (L 34-27) as they did (L 28-21),
We gave Ohio State a decent game (51-10) compared to them (56-27).
Yes, they beat us - but we were competitive and comparable.
The next "best" team to beat us - Penn State.
They beat us 34-27
They beat Maryland 59-0, Purdue 35-7, Michigan 28-21, Michigan State 28-7.
Yeah, they beat us, but again, we were competitive.
Lastly, OSU beat us 51-10.
They beat Maryland 73-14. We beat Maryland 34-28.
They beat Michigan 56-27.
They beat Rutgers 56-21.We beat Rutgers 35-0.
They beat NW 52-3. We beat NW 34-3.
They beat Nebraska 48-7. We Nebraska 38-31.
They beat MSU 34-10.
They beat PSU 28-17.
So, MSU, Michigan and PSU we lost 113-72 (avg. 37.7 to 24).
Ohio State clocked everybody.
I'd say we can say we held up pretty well.
